Job Description
As a Lead Site Reliability Engineer at JPMorgan Chase in the Commercial & Investment Bank's Digital & Platform Services division, you hold a leadership role in your team, demonstrate strong knowledge across multiple technical domains, and advise others on the technical and business issues facing them. Take lead and conduct resiliency design reviews, break up complex problems into digestible work for other engineers, act as a technical lead for medium to large-sized products, and provide advice and mentoring to other engineers.
This role will involve designing, managing and maintaining tools to automate operational processes on AWS. You will also collaborate with team members to identify comprehensive service level indicators and work with stakeholders to establish reasonable service level objectives and error budgets with customers.
Job responsibilities

  • Manage incident response to swiftly mitigate business impacts by coordinating cross-functional teams.
  • Serve as the primary point of contact during major incidents, demonstrating the ability to quickly identify and resolve issues to prevent financial losses.
  • Participate in 24x7 support coverage as required.
  • Oversee, track, and validate all changes to the Production and Disaster Recovery environments.
  • Automate security controls, governance processes, and compliance validation on AWS.
  • Lead initiatives to enhance the reliability and stability of team applications and platforms, utilizing data-driven analytics to improve service levels.
  • Document and share knowledge within the organization through internal forums and communities of practice.
  • Provide ongoing guidance, tools, and solutions to support the firm's growth.
  • Champion and demonstrate site reliability culture and practices, exerting technical influence throughout the team.
  • Exhibit a high level of technical expertise in one or more domains, proactively identifying and resolving technology-related bottlenecks.
  • Strive to become an expert on the applications and platforms under your purview, understanding their interdependencies and limitations.


Required qualifications, capabilities, and skills

  • Formal training or certification on software engineering concepts and proficient advanced experience.
  • Deep proficiency in reliability, scalability, performance, security, enterprise system architecture, toil reduction, and other site reliability best practices with the ability to implement these practices within an application or platform
  • Fluency in at least one programming language such as (e.g., Python, Java Spring Boot, Go, Shell Script, etc.)
  • Deep knowledge of software applications and technical processes with emerging depth in one or more technical disciplines
  • Proficiency and experience in observability such as white and black box monitoring, SLO alerting, and telemetry collection using tools such as Grafana, Dynatrace, Prometheus, Datadog, Splunk, etc.
  • Proficiency and experience in Cloud Platform (AWS) infrastructure and setting up monitoring / observability for application migrated to cloud platforms.
  • Proficiency in continuous integration and continuous delivery tools (e.g., Jenkins, GitLab, Terraform, etc.)
  • Experience with container and container orchestration (e.g., ECS, Kubernetes, Docker, etc.)
  • Experience with troubleshooting common networking technologies and issues
  • Ability to identify and solve problems related to complex data structures, algorithms and new technologies and if needed self-educate on new technology
  • Ability to expand and collaborate across different levels and stakeholder groups


Preferred qualifications, capabilities, and skills

  • Ability to identify new technologies and relevant solutions to ensure design constraints are met by the software team
  • Ability to initiate and implement ideas to solve business problem
  • Experience building dashboards with products such as Grafana
  • Prior experience in both Systems Engineering and Software Development
  • AWS certification as an Architect, DevOps is preferred

What We Do

JPMorgan Chase & Co. (NYSE: JPM) is a leading global financial services firm with assets of $3.7 trillion and operations worldwide. The firm is a leader in investment banking, financial services for consumers and small businesses, commercial banking, financial transaction processing, and asset management. A component of the Dow Jones Industrial Average, JPMorgan Chase & Co. serves millions of consumers in the United States and many of the world’s most prominent corporate, institutional and government clients under its J.P. Morgan and Chase brands.

Technology fuels every aspect of our company and is at the heart of everything we do. With over 50,000 technologists globally and an annual tech spend of $12 billion, we are dedicated to improving the design, analytics, development, coding, testing and application programming that goes into creating high quality software and new products.
